Domaine Comte de Vogüé, Chambolle-Musigny 1er cru 2010

By Steen Öhman May 9, 2014 -

The Chambolle Musigny 1er cru 2010 from Vogue is a truly lovely wine with tremendous nerve and energy. In the bouquet lovely cool and crystal clear red fruit - forest strawberries, raspberries with perfumed tones of grape fruit and a lovely intense minerality. On the palate beautiful lively red …

Domaine Georges Noellat, Vosne Les Chaumes 2012

By Steen Öhman May 7, 2014 -

The Vosne-Romanee Les Chaumes 2012 is a step up from the village wine. In the nose red and dark berry fruit - ripe and pure - spiced with Vosne minerality and a quite discrete impression of oak. On the palate silky transparent fruit - lightfooted but more weight that the village - with a lovely …

French cellar talk

  • Egrappage: Destemming
  • Éraflage : Destalking
  • Foulage: Crushing or stirring
  • Encuvage: Vatting
  • Pigeage: Cap Punching down
  • Remontage: Pumping Over
  • Fermentation Alcoolique: Alcoholic Fermentation
  • Ecoulage: Running off
  • Décuvage: Devatting
  • Pressurage: Pressing
  • Assemblage: Blending
  • Débourbage: Must Settling
  • Bourbes: Lies (general translation)
  • Fermentation Malolactique: Malolactic Fermentation
  • Soutirage: Racking
  • Sulfitage: Sulphiting
  • Elevage: Maturing
  • Collage: Fining
  • Filtration: Filtration
  • Mise en bouteilles: Bottling
